After executing the following the file is locked. How do I unlock the
file, from within the RPG? Service program. No suggestions of the
following please:
- seton LR
- RCLACTGRP
- ENDJOB
C/EXEC SQL
C+ Select data into :NameWork from zpal01
C+ where pkey = 'COMPANY '
C/END-EXEC
C If sqlcod=0
C Return NameWork
C Else
C Eval Cmd='SNDPPGMMSG MSGID(CPF9898) '+
C 'MSGDTA(' + apostrophe +
C 'Attempt to access ZPAL01 for ' +
C 'COMPANY record resulted in an ' +
C 'SQL code of ' +
C %trim(%editc(sqlcod:'Z')) +
C apostrophe +
C ') MSGTYPE(*ESCAPE) ' +
C 'MSGF(QCPFMSG)'
C Eval Status=ExecCmd(Cmd)
C Return *blanks
C EndIf
Isolation clause?
For read only clause?
